Dangrove Arts Centre

Linear lighting solutions with impressive continuous runs spanning over 40 meters

Dangrove is a new 10,000sq m, secure state-of-the-art storage facility designed for both the storage of a globally significant collection of contemporary Chinese art, and as a creative environment for art curation, conservation and interaction.

The building is designed by Tzannes Architects to museum standards with a 100-year life and engineered for the lowest net energy use and carbon footprint Steensen Varming with final electrical documentation by Simpson Kotzman

Linear lighting elements are a major design factor throughout the facility and is used in areas as diverse as the corridors storage rooms, loading dock (IP55 Profiles), and gallery areas. Many of the spaces employed high CRI 90+ LED boards to ensure colours were rendered truly

Austube have been a major supplier for all the linear components of the project with some continuous runs in excess of 40 metres down the central storage corridors and unique custom fittings encompassing alternate components of linear LED diffused sections interspersed with sections of track lighting embedded into the profile
